Netflix: what to watch this week on the platform

As we told you, there are few new releases in the red N service, but that doesn't mean you won't be left without enjoying news. Watch out for what's coming.

  • Tuesday February 23

Footballer to death? Then surely you like this documentary. It turns out that tomorrow Tuesday you will have to see Pele about the famous Brazilian player (actually called Edson Arantes do Nascimento). Indispensable for fans of the king of sports in general and of the soccer star in particular.

  • Wednesday February 24

We have a new series on the horizon with Ginny and Georgia. Season 1 of this fresh proposal reaches its full length to tell us about Georgia, who moves north with her two children looking for a new life.

  • Friday February 26

youth movie Booksmart lands on Netflix Friday to tell us how studious Molly and Amy swear to make up for lost time on the eve of their high school graduation.

Another cinematographic proposal that you will have at your fingertips is Look, the girl on the train, in which a tormented divorcee, obsessed with the perfect partner, accidentally witnesses a crime scene. The Indian proposal is based on the famous novel "The Girl on the Train"

Last but not least, you will be able to laugh with the new Spanish romantic comedy (produced by Netflix) Crazy for her, in which an incredible night together, Adri decides to look for the girl he has fallen in love with, even being willing to become a patient at the psychiatric center where she resides. With Álvaro Cervantes and Susana Abaitua.

What to watch this week on HBO

A controversial documentary, a DC series... without being HBO's most prolific week, you'll be able to find the occasional curious proposal this week on the platform.

  • Monday February 22

Haunted premieres episode 4 of its third season. We also have the arrival of a new proposal: the first chapter of the controversial documentary Allow v. Farrow, in which the case of alleged sexual abuse by Woody Allen of his adoptive daughter while he was a partner of Mia Farrow (and for which a particular director was acquitted in the 90s) is removed again. It has not been a production to the liking of many, who see in this documentary a mere revenge by Farrow to return it to Allen. The controversy is served.
